Abstract

Detecting Segments for Aerosol-Generating Articles with Two Consecutive Sensors A method for conducting a quality control of an arrangement (3) of segments for aerosol-generating articles is provided. The arrangement (3) of segments comprises at least two segments arranged consecutively along a longitudinal axis (15), wherein each segment extends along the longitudinal axis (15) between two opposing longitudinal ends of the segment. The at least two segments comprise at least one aerosol-generating segment (17). The at least one aerosol-generating segment (17) comprises an aerosol-generating material (21) and a susceptor (19). The susceptor (19) comprises a metallic material for heating the aerosol-generating material (21). The method comprises carrying out a first measurement comprising detecting the susceptor (19) by magnetic interaction with the metallic material of the susceptor (19). The method further comprises carrying out a second measurement comprising optically detecting at least one longitudinal end of at least one of the segments.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. Method for conducting a quality control of an arrangement of segments for aerosol-generating articles,
 wherein the arrangement of segments comprises at least two segments arranged consecutively along a longitudinal axis, wherein each segment extends along the longitudinal axis between two opposing longitudinal ends of the segment;   wherein the at least two segments comprise at least one aerosol-generating segment;   wherein the at least one aerosol-generating segment comprises an aerosol-generating material and a susceptor;   wherein the susceptor comprises a metallic material for heating the aerosol-generating material; and   wherein the method comprises
 carrying out a first measurement comprising detecting the susceptor by magnetic interaction with the metallic material of the susceptor; and 
 carrying out a second measurement comprising optically detecting at least one longitudinal end of at least one of the segments, wherein the second measurement comprises detecting a position of the at least one longitudinal end along the longitudinal axis.

         3 . Method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least two segments comprise at least one of: a filter segment, or a segment with a hollow acetate tube, or a mouthpiece segment. 
     
     
         4 . Method according to  claim 1 , wherein the arrangement of segments further comprises a wrapper wrapped around the at least two segments. 
     
     
         5 . Method according to  claim 1 , wherein the second measurement comprises detecting the at least one longitudinal end by an optical transmission measurement. 
     
     
         6 . Method according to  claim 1 , wherein the second measurement comprises detecting an interface of adjacent segments. 
     
     
         7 . Method according to  claim 1 , wherein the first measurement comprises inducing electrical currents in the susceptor by magnetic interaction with the susceptor. 
     
     
         8 . Method according to  claim 1 , further comprising conveying the arrangement of segments, wherein one or both of the first measurement and the second measurement are carried out while the arrangement of segments is conveyed. 
     
     
         9 . Method according to  claim 1 , further comprising separating the arrangement of segments from at least a further arrangement of segments between the first measurement and the second measurement. 
     
     
         10 . Method according to  claim 1 , further comprising evaluating data from the first measurement and data from the second measurement to determine lengths of the individual segments of the arrangement of segments. 
     
     
         11 . System for conducting a quality control of an arrangement of segments for aerosol-generating articles,
 wherein the arrangement of segments comprises at least two segments arranged consecutively along a longitudinal axis, wherein each segment extends along the longitudinal axis between two opposing longitudinal ends of the segment;   wherein the at least two segments comprise at least one aerosol-generating segment;   wherein the at least one aerosol-generating segment comprises an aerosol-generating material and a susceptor;   wherein the susceptor comprises a metallic material for heating the aerosol-generating material; and   wherein the system comprises
 a first measurement station comprising a magnetic detector configured to detect the susceptor by magnetic interaction with the metallic material of the susceptor; 
 a second measurement station comprising an optical detector configured to optically detect at least one longitudinal end of at least one of the segments, wherein the optical detector is configured to detect a position of the at least one longitudinal end along the longitudinal axis; and 
 a conveying system configured to convey the arrangement of segments along a transport path through the first measurement station and the second measurement station. 
   
     
     
         12 . System according to  claim 11 , wherein the magnetic detector comprises at least one detection coil and a measurement device for measuring a current flowing through the detection coil. 
     
     
         13 . System according to  claim 11 , wherein the magnetic detector comprises an excitation. coil configured to induce electrical currents in the susceptor. 
     
     
         14 . System according to  claim 11 , wherein the magnetic detector is configured to detect a position of the susceptor in a radial direction perpendicular to the longitudinal direction.

         16 . System according to  claim 11 , wherein the optical detector is configured to detect an interface of adjacent segments. 
     
     
         17 . System according to  claim 11 , further comprising a cutting station arranged between the first measurement station and the second measurement station, the cutting station being configured to separate the arrangement of segments from at least a further arrangement of segments. 
     
     
         18 . System according to  claim 11 , wherein the optical detector comprises a light source and a light detector, the light source and the light detector being arranged on opposing sides of the transport path. 
     
     
         19 . System according to  claim 11 , further comprising a computing device configured to determine lengths of the individual segments of the arrangement of segments by combining measurement data from the first measurement station with measurement data from the second measurement station.
